Pulp Sartre

Easy to forget that the publishers of Jean-Paul Sartre, Aldous Huxley, Mary Shelley, and William Faulkner… were in it for the money, too.

The above images and others in the following gallery (click for full images, of course) all come from a big zip file offered free by Geoff E of Retrogasm, one of my favorite image blogs.
